Description

George Barr McCutcheon (1866-1928) was an American popular novelist and playwright, best known for Brewster's Millions and a series of novels set in Graustark, a fictional East European country. West Wind Drift is another name for the Antarctic Circumpolar Current. McCutcheon's novel tells the story a great modern liner shipwrecked on an uninhabited island, where the passengers build homes, establish a government and laws, and keep 'the fires of courage burning through the years that follow.'
